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Turbo, Colombia and Venezuela?

Easyfly, AeroRepública, and two other airlines fly from Antonio Roldán Betancourt Airport (APO) to Simón Bolívar International Airport (CCS) once daily.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Turbo to Terminal TransChacao Ruta 5 via Terminal del Norte, Terminal Cúcuta, San Antonio del Táchira, Terminal Expresos Los Llanos Caracas, and Parada 20 in around 36h 16m.
